Tangeretin Mitigates Trimethylamine Oxide Induced Arterial Inflammation by Disrupting Choline-Trimethylamine Conversion through Specific Manipulation of Intestinal Microflora.
Previous studies have revealed the microbial metabolism of dietary choline in the gut, leading to its conversion into trimethylamine (TMA). Polymethoxyflavones (PMFs), exemplified by tangeretin, have shown efficacy in mitigating choline-induced cardiovascular inflammation. However, the specific mechanism by which these compounds exert their effects, particularly in modulating the gut microbiota, remains uncertain. This investigation focused on tangeretin, a representative PMFs, to explore its influence on the gut microbiota and the choline-TMA conversion process. Experimental results showed that tangeretin treatment significantly attenuated the population of CutC-active bacteria, particularly and , induced by choline chloride in rat models. This inhibition led to a decreased efficiency in choline conversion to TMA, thereby ameliorating cardiovascular inflammation resulting from prolonged choline consumption. In conclusion, tangeretin's preventive effect against cardiovascular inflammation is intricately linked to its targeted modulation of TMA-producing bacterial activity.

Medicina (Kaunas, Lithuania) Mar 2024: Takayasu's arteritis is a rare type of vasculitis with severe complications like stroke, ischemic heart disease, pulmonary hypertension, secondary hypertension, and... (Review)
Review
: Takayasu's arteritis is a rare type of vasculitis with severe complications like stroke, ischemic heart disease, pulmonary hypertension, secondary hypertension, and aneurysms. Diagnosis is achieved using clinical and angiographic criteria. Treatment is medical and surgical, but unfortunately, the outcome is limited. : A 34-year-old Caucasian woman had an ischemic stroke (2009). She was diagnosed with Takayasu's arteritis and received treatment with methotrexate, prednisolone, and antiplatelet agents, with a mild improvement in clinical state. After 6 years (2015), she experienced an ascending aorta aneurysm, pulmonary hypertension, and mild aortic regurgitation. Surgical treatment solved both the ascending aorta aneurysm and left carotid artery stenosis (ultrasound in 2009 and computed tomography angiogram in 2014). Morphopathology revealed a typical case of Takayasu's arteritis. Tumor necrosis factor inhibitors (TNF inhibitors) were prescribed with methotrexate. At 48 years old (2023), she developed coronary heart disease (angina, electrocardiogram); echocardiography revealed severe pulmonary hypertension, and angiography revealed normal coronary arteries, abdominal aorta pseudoaneurysm, and arterial-venous fistula originating in the right coronary artery with drainage in the medium pulmonary artery. The patient refused surgical/interventional treatment. She again received TNF inhibitors, methotrexate, antiplatelet agents, and statins. : This case report presented a severe form of Takayasu's arteritis. Our patient had multiple arterial complications, as previously mentioned. She received immunosuppressive treatment, medication targeted to coronary heart disease, and surgical therapy.

Medicina (Kaunas, Lithuania) Feb 2024Giant cell arteritis (GCA) is a large-vessel vasculitis affecting elderly patients and targeting the aorta and its main branches, leading to cranial and extracranial... (Review)
Review
Giant cell arteritis (GCA) is a large-vessel vasculitis affecting elderly patients and targeting the aorta and its main branches, leading to cranial and extracranial manifestations. The mechanism behind the ischemia is a granulomatous-type inflammation with potentially critical lesions, including visual loss involving the ophthalmic artery. Despite significant progress in unraveling the pathophysiology of this disease, treatment options still rely on glucocorticoids (GCs) to overcome active vascular lesions and disease flares. However, uncertainty still revolves around the optimal dose and tapering rhythm. Few corticosteroid-sparing agents have proven useful in GCA, namely, methotrexate and tocilizumab, benefiting cumulative GC dose and relapse-free intervals. The future looks promising with regard to using other agents like abatacept and Janus-kinase inhibitors or blocking the granulocyte-macrophage colony-stimulating factor receptor.

Seminars in Nuclear Medicine Mar 2024Systemic vasculitides are autoimmune diseases characterized by inflammation of blood vessels. They are categorized based on the size of the preferentially affected blood... (Review)
Review
Systemic vasculitides are autoimmune diseases characterized by inflammation of blood vessels. They are categorized based on the size of the preferentially affected blood vessels: large-, medium-, and small-vessel vasculitides. The main forms of large-vessel vasculitis include giant cell arteritis (GCA) and Takayasu arteritis (TAK). Depending on the location of the affected vessels, various imaging modalities can be employed for diagnosis of large vessel vasculitis: ultrasonography (US), magnetic resonance angiography (MRA), computed tomography angiography (CTA), and [F]-fluoro-2-deoxy-d-glucose positron emission tomography/computed tomography (FDG-PET/CT). These imaging tools offer complementary information about vascular changes occurring in vasculitis. Recent advances in PET imaging in large vessel vasculitis include the introduction of digital long axial field-of-view PET/CT, dedicated acquisition, quantitative methodologies, and the availability of novel radiopharmaceuticals. This review aims to provide an update on the current status of PET imaging in large vessel vasculitis and to share the latest developments on imaging vasculitides.

RMD Open Mar 2024This study aimed to estimate the incidence of giant cell arteritis (GCA) in Spain and to analyse its clinical manifestations, and distribution by age group, sex,...
OBJECTIVE
This study aimed to estimate the incidence of giant cell arteritis (GCA) in Spain and to analyse its clinical manifestations, and distribution by age group, sex, geographical area and season.
METHODS
We included all patients diagnosed with GCA between 1 June 2013 and 29 March 2019 at 26 hospitals of the National Health System. They had to be aged ≥50 years and have at least one positive results in an objective diagnostic test (biopsy or imaging techniques), meet 3/5 of the 1990 American College of Rheumatology classification criteria or have a clinical diagnosis based on the expert opinion of the physician in charge. We calculated incidence rate using Poisson regression and assessed the influence of age, sex, geographical area and season.
RESULTS
We identified 1675 cases of GCA with a mean age at diagnosis of 76.9±8.3 years. The annual incidence was estimated at 7.42 (95% CI 6.57 to 8.27) cases of GCA per 100 000 people ≥50 years with a peak for patients aged 80-84 years (23.06 (95% CI 20.89 to 25.4)). The incidence was greater in women (10.06 (95% CI 8.7 to 11.5)) than in men (4.83 (95% CI 3.8 to 5.9)). No significant differences were found between geographical distribution and incidence throughout the year (p=0.125). The phenotypes at diagnosis were cranial in 1091 patients, extracranial in 337 patients and mixed in 170 patients.
CONCLUSIONS
This is the first study to estimate the incidence of GCA in Spain at a national level. We found a predominance among women and during the ninth decade of life with no clear variability according to geographical area or seasons of the year.

Korean Journal of Radiology Apr 2024To evaluate the image quality of novel dark-blood computed tomography angiography (CTA) imaging combined with deep learning reconstruction (DLR) compared to...
OBJECTIVE
To evaluate the image quality of novel dark-blood computed tomography angiography (CTA) imaging combined with deep learning reconstruction (DLR) compared to delayed-phase CTA images with hybrid iterative reconstruction (HIR), to visualize the cervical artery wall in patients with Takayasu arteritis (TAK).
MATERIALS AND METHODS
This prospective study continuously recruited 53 patients with TAK (mean age: 33.8 ± 10.2 years; 49 females) between January and July 2022 who underwent head-neck CTA scans. The arterial- and delayed-phase images were reconstructed using HIR and DLR. Subtracted images of the arterial-phase from the delayed-phase were then added to the original delayed-phase using a denoising filter to generate the final-dark-blood images. Qualitative image quality scores and quantitative parameters were obtained and compared among the three groups of images: Delayed-HIR, Dark-blood-HIR, and Dark-blood-DLR.
RESULTS
Compared to Delayed-HIR, Dark-blood-HIR images demonstrated higher qualitative scores in terms of vascular wall visualization and diagnostic confidence index (all < 0.001). These qualitative scores further improved after applying DLR (Dark-blood-DLR compared to Dark-blood-HIR, all < 0.001). Dark-blood DLR also showed higher scores for overall image noise than Dark-blood-HIR ( < 0.001). In the quantitative analysis, the contrast-to-noise ratio (CNR) values between the vessel wall and lumen for the bilateral common carotid arteries and brachiocephalic trunk were significantly higher on Dark-blood-HIR images than on Delayed-HIR images (all < 0.05). The CNR values were significantly higher for Dark-blood-DLR than for Dark-blood-HIR in all cervical arteries (all < 0.001).
CONCLUSION
Compared with Delayed-HIR CTA, the dark-blood method combined with DLR improved CTA image quality and enhanced visualization of the cervical artery wall in patients with TAK.

Clinical and Experimental Rheumatology Apr 2024Giant cell arteritis (GCA) in patients with systemic sclerosis (SSc) is rare, and optimal treatment strategies for this group of patients have not been defined. We aim...
OBJECTIVES
Giant cell arteritis (GCA) in patients with systemic sclerosis (SSc) is rare, and optimal treatment strategies for this group of patients have not been defined. We aim to describe the first case series of GCA/SSc overlap.
METHODS
A single-institution retrospective study was performed reviewing all patients that had diagnosis codes for both SSc and GCA between January 1, 1996, and December 31, 2020. Demographic characteristic, clinical presentation, diagnostic modality, treatment, and outcome data were abstracted. Diagnosis of both SSc and GCA by a rheumatologist was required for inclusion.
RESULTS
Eight patients were retrospectively identified, all of which were female. Seven patients fully met both respective ACR/EULAR classification criteria sets. One patient fulfilled GCA criteria and had 8/9 points for SSc criteria plus an oesophagogram which was consistent with clinical diagnosis of SSc. Three patients had a previous history of scleroderma renal crisis (SRC) prior to glucocorticoid initiation for GCA. No episodes of SRC occurred following initiation of glucocorticoids. Three patients were treated with tocilizumab. One patient developed a diverticular perforation while on tocilizumab requiring colonic resection and colostomy, one patient discontinued tocilizumab after a medication-unrelated complication and one patient has remained on treatment and in remission.
CONCLUSIONS
Herein we present the largest single-institution series of patients with a history of GCA and SSc, an uncommon combination. Glucocorticoid treatment for GCA did not precipitate SRC, even in those with prior history of SRC. Further investigation regarding the benefit of tocilizumab in patients with SSc and GCA is required.

Journal of Equine Science Mar 2024Equine testicular arteritis commonly occurs as a consequence of the migration of nematode larvae or equine arteritis virus (EAV) infection. However, testicular arteritis...
Equine testicular arteritis commonly occurs as a consequence of the migration of nematode larvae or equine arteritis virus (EAV) infection. However, testicular arteritis without evidence of these infections has been reported, and the underlying pathogenesis remains unclear. We encountered testicular arteritis without evidence of nematode or EAV infection in a 3-year-old male heavy draft horse with scrotal enlargement. Grossly, the volume of the pampiniform plexus was markedly increased due to edema. Histologically, non-suppurative and necrotizing testicular arteritis, characterized by lymphocyte infiltration and fibrinoid necrosis of the arterial walls, was diffusely observed in the spermatic cord, pampiniform plexus (most severe), testis, and epididymis. We were unable to identify the cause of arteritis, such as a viral infection or autoimmune abnormality.

Clinical Case Reports Mar 2024The rare co-occurrence of takayasu arteritis (TAK) and ulcerative colitis (UC), presenting with asymptomatic onset and neurological complications, highlights the...
KEY CLINICAL MESSAGE
The rare co-occurrence of takayasu arteritis (TAK) and ulcerative colitis (UC), presenting with asymptomatic onset and neurological complications, highlights the importance of an integrated diagnostic approach for overlapping autoimmune conditions.
ABSTRACT
We present a rare case of a 44-year-old female diagnosed with both UC and TAK, characterized by an unusual acute asymptomatic onset accompanied by neurological manifestations. The patient exhibited symptoms of acute ischemic stroke along with vascular abnormalities, as well as colon inflammation associated with UC. The patient's asymptomatic presentation at the onset differs from previously reported cases. The presence of additional complications, such as hepatocellular adenoma and primary sclerosing cholangitis, further complicated the diagnostic challenges. The patient's treatment involved a combination of methylprednisolone, azathioprine, and prednisolone leading to improved clinical outcomes. This case emphasizes the complexity involved in diagnosing overlapping conditions and highlights the significance of TAK in presenting atypical manifestations in relation to UC. Furthermore, this case contributes to the limited literature, underscoring the need for early detection and comprehensive treatment approaches.

JBMR Plus Apr 2024Bisphosphonates frequently provoke a cytokine-driven acute clinical response (ACR) characterized by fever, chills, arthralgias, and myalgias. More rarely, an association...
Bisphosphonates frequently provoke a cytokine-driven acute clinical response (ACR) characterized by fever, chills, arthralgias, and myalgias. More rarely, an association between aminobisphosphonates, such as alendronate and zoledronic acid, and rheumatologic and/or immune-mediated syndromes (RIMS) has been described. Herein we report 2 patients, one with a prior history of rheumatic disease and one without, who developed giant cell arteritis meeting the American College of Rheumatology 2022 criteria following zoledronic acid infusion. We subsequently review existing mechanistic and clinical literature supporting this link. The duration of symptoms and elevation of inflammatory markers may serve as indicators for differentiating between the more common ACR and less frequent but potentially morbid RIMS. Although the benefit of bisphosphonates will outweigh the risk of RIMS for most patients with high fracture risk, clinicians should be aware of this phenomenon to assist earlier diagnosis and treatment in affected individuals.
